Ticket: Staging env misconfigured for Siftgate bloom filter

The bloom layer in front of the Pellet KV store is rejecting all lookups in staging because the env file was copied from the dev template without credentials. False-positive tuning values are fine; only the auth line is missing. To unblock the weekly demo, the Pellet admission secret must be set on the following line.

env line for yaguf-fajop: LEDGER_TOKEN13=fb08984397349

## Authentication

If your plugin hooks into the StockSquare reconciliation job, it needs to call our internal ledger service, and that means bringing a key along. Plugins without one get rejected before the first batch runs, no exceptions. Pop it into your plugin config under the auth section. The key to use is below.

app token of hahig-yawip = zpat11_7vvKNZ1kAOl

Subject: Key rotation — Ledgerfin retry service

Team,

We rotated the Ledgerfin credential today as part of quarterly hygiene. Reminder for new folks: every payment retry must reuse the original idempotency key, or Ledgerfin will treat it as a new charge. Keys live for 72 hours; after that, open a reconciliation ticket instead of retrying. Old credentials stop working Friday. Update your local env before then. The new service key is below.

— Marisol

service key, kaduf-bawig: kto15_Ze79S0dligTw0yO

## Formula sandbox tuning

User-supplied formulas in Gridmoor execute inside a restricted interpreter with hard ceilings on time, memory, and call depth. Reviewers should confirm any change to these ceilings is justified in the PR description, since raising them widens the abuse surface. Defaults were chosen from production traces. The current limits are as follows.

limits module of tafog-fawip:
WEIGHTS = {
    "julix": 57,
    "lamys": 992,
    "kasvan": 209,
    "quenok": 750,
    "alddor": 259,
    "oliath": 1009,
    "wenix": 815,
}